Matlab/Simulink开发环境论述
时间: 2024-01-08 13:05:03 浏览: 60
Matlab/Simulink是一个强大的开发环境,用于模拟、分析和设计各种系统,包括控制系统、信号处理、通信系统、图像处理、机器学习等等。以下是Matlab/Simulink开发环境的主要特点:
1. 简便易用:Matlab/Simulink的用户界面友好,学习曲线平稳,容易掌握。
2. 强大的数学计算功能:Matlab/Simulink提供了丰富的数学计算功能,包括矩阵计算、数值分析、符号计算等等。
3. 丰富的工具箱:Matlab/Simulink提供了众多的工具箱,包括控制系统工具箱、信号处理工具箱、图像处理工具箱等等,可以大大提升系统设计的效率。
4. 可视化建模:Simulink提供了可视化建模功能,可以直观地设计、分析和测试系统模型。
5. 跨平台支持:Matlab/Simulink可以在不同的操作系统上运行,包括Windows、Linux和Mac OS等等。
总之,Matlab/Simulink提供了一个全面、高效、易用的开发环境,可以帮助工程师和科学家快速设计、分析和实现各种系统。
相关问题
matlab/simulink 开发autosar模型快速入门
MATLAB/Simulink是一款功能强大的工具,可用于快速开发AUTOSAR模型。AUTOSAR(Automotive Open System Architecture)是一种标准化的软件架构,确保汽车电子和软件可以更好地互操作。
要开发AUTOSAR模型,需要掌握以下步骤:
1.安装Simulink AUTOSAR Blockset。该工具包包含AUTOSAR模型中常用的块和库。
2.创建新的AUTOSAR模型。在Simulink中,创建新模型并选择AUTOSAR模型模板。
3.添加模块和端口。为模型添加所需的模块和端口,以及模块之间的连线。
4.配置AUTOSAR元素。为每个模块和端口添加AUTOSAR组件。
5.生成和导出ARXML文件。使用Simulink生成ARXML文件,确保符合AUTOSAR标准,并手动进行必要的编辑。
6.集成代码和测试。将生成的代码集成到汽车电子设备中,并进行测试。
通过这些步骤,您可以快速入门和开发AUTOSAR模型。MATLAB/Simulink可以大大简化AUTOSAR模型的开发过程,降低开发难度,提高开发效率。
matlab/simulink电路仿真
Matlab/Simulink是一种常用的电路仿真工具,它可以帮助工程师们快速地建立电路模型并进行仿真分析。通过Matlab/Simulink,用户可以方便地进行电路分析、设计和优化,同时还可以进行系统级仿真和控制设计。在电力电子领域,Matlab/Simulink也被广泛应用于各种电路的仿真分析,例如Buck电路、Boost-Buck电路等。通过Matlab/Simulink,用户可以快速地建立电路模型,进行仿真分析,并得到仿真波形和仿真结果。同时,Matlab/Simulink还提供了丰富的工具箱和函数库,可以帮助用户进行更加深入的电路分析和设计。如果您对Matlab/Simulink电路仿真有兴趣,可以通过引用和引用中提供的源码进行学习和实践。